New partner announcement

Cozens-Hardy is delighted to confirm the promotion of Claire Nelson from associate to partner in the firm’s highly respected private client department.

Claire has been with the firm since 2014 when she joined as a trainee solicitor. Having qualified as a solicitor two years later, she was promoted to associate in 2019. Claire has extensive experience in all aspects of private client work and recently qualified as a full member of the Society of Trusts and Estates Practitioners (STEP).

“We are delighted that Claire is joining the partnership,” commented Jane Anderson, senior partner. “She is a fantastic lawyer with an excellent academic record, having recently completed her STEP qualification with outstanding results. Claire is popular with both clients and colleagues and she will be a great asset to the firm, both now and in years to come.”

A graduate of the UEA law school, Claire’s areas of expertise include will drafting, lasting powers of attorney, declarations of trust, dealing with the administration of estates, setting up trusts and inheritance tax planning.
